ABSTRACT:
In this system, reflected light from an electro-optic probe is detected by a photodetector, and only a voltage signal of a frequency which is an integral multiple of the fundamental frequency of the output voltage from the photodetector is detected. The frequency characteristics of the output voltage from the photodetector can be measured at a high speed and a high accuracy.
